Array rückwärts

Informationen und Beispiele zu den hier genannten Dialog-Elementen:
ListBox
Bild

Betrifft: Array rückwärts von: Berta
Geschrieben am: 07.02.2005 14:00:32

Hi Leute,
brauch mal Hilfe!

Ich habe eine Listbox, dort stehen Dateinamen (z.B. 13 Stück, variabel)drin.
Diese möchte ich jetzt aber umgekehrt in der ListBox zeigen.
Wollte dies über ein Array machen, also Listbox in Array einlesen und umgekehrt ausgeben, sprich letzt eingelesener Wert als erstes raus.
Hab schon viel im Netz geschaut, aber ich finde keinen richtigen Ansatz!

Freue mich über jede gute Idee! Danke
MfG
Berta

Bild


Betrifft: AW: Array rückwärts von: harry
Geschrieben am: 07.02.2005 15:29:26

hi,
weiss nicht, wie der code zum füllen des arrays aussieht, aber hier ein beispiel für eine solche schleife:

For i = 10 to 1 Step - 1
...
Next i

liebe grüße,
harry


Bild


Betrifft: AW: Array rückwärts von: Berta
Geschrieben am: 08.02.2005 08:00:16

Danke Harry,
aber leider fängt er damit nicht von hinten an das Array abzubauen.
Naja, muss ich halt weiter suchen.
Danke trotzdem!
Berta


Bild


Betrifft: AW: Array rückwärts von: harry
Geschrieben am: 08.02.2005 09:43:21

hi,
kopier das mal in ein modul:

Sub array_rückw()
Dim zaHlen() As Long
ReDim zaHlen(10)
For i = 1 To 10
    zaHlen(i) = i
Next i
For j = i - 1 To 1 Step -1
    a = a + 1
    ActiveSheet.Cells(a, 1).Value = zaHlen(j)
Next j
End Sub


funkt doch, oder?

liebe grüße,
harry


Bild


Betrifft: AW: Array rückwärts von: Berta
Geschrieben am: 08.02.2005 12:49:32

hi harry,
das ist zwar eine Möglichkeit, aber nicht die passende für mich.
ich gabe eine listbox, die ist sortiert. diese will ich nun in ein array einlesen, listenbox löschen, array rückwärts wieder ausgeben. an der sortierung innerhalb der listbox soll nichts geändert werden, nur eben von hinten nach vorne.
danke
berta


Bild


Betrifft: AW: Array rückwärts von: harry
Geschrieben am: 08.02.2005 15:13:54

das meinte ich ja auch. vielleicht ist dir das klarer.

https://www.herber.de/bbs/user/17638.xls

liebe grüße,
harry


 Bild

Beiträge aus den Excel-Beispielen zum Thema "Datensätze bequem über Maske eingeben - aber wie?"